The Short Version
- •Rent is 69% cheaper in Chiang Mai ($463/mo vs $1498/mo for a 1BR city centre).
- •Madrid is safer by homicide rate (0.6 vs 4.8 per 100k).
- •Madrid scores higher on democracy (8.1 vs 6.3 / 10 EIU).
- •English is easier to get by in Madrid (62/100 vs 22/100 English proficiency).

Is Chiang Mai cheaper than Madrid?▾
Chiang Mai is cheaper. A 1-bedroom apartment in city centre costs around $463/month in Chiang Mai vs $1498/month in the other city (Numbeo data).
Which is safer, Chiang Mai or Madrid?▾
Madrid is statistically safer based on UNODC homicide data. Chiang Mai has a rate of 4.79 per 100,000 and Madrid has 0.61 per 100,000.

Is it easier to get residency in Chiang Mai or Madrid?▾
Chiang Mai: Thailand LTR Visa (complex process, 10 years). Madrid: Spain Digital Nomad Visa (moderate requirements, 1 year (renewable to 5)). See each city's profile page for full requirements.
Can I live in Chiang Mai or Madrid without speaking the local language?▾
English is easier to get by in Madrid (EF EPI score: 62/100) than in Chiang Mai (22/100). In Madrid, daily life and professional settings often work in English. In Chiang Mai, learning some of the local language will make long-term settlement significantly smoother.
